I recently went to downtown Redlands, CA to check out the new location of Collective Journey. Actually, the store is now called “Crackerjacks”. When I first started going to the store location on State Street in Redlands, it was called Cracker Jack Too! and the gift shop portion, two doors down the street, was called Cracerkjack Gift Co. A few years later, the store merged and moved to another location, renaming itself Collective Journey. Now the store has down-sized and has moved back to State Street, calling itself Crackerjack once again.

The store is small but the staff have done a great job of packing in wonderful, thoughtful gift items and craft supplies. The feel is like a boutique more than a craft store. It's really a much different experience than the giant scrapbook store of before.
